Tanya: The Kabbalah of You - Class 1




This class explores the historical roots of the Tanya. The condition of the Jewish community in the European heartland in the second half of the seventeenth century, the founding of the Chassidic movement by the Baal Shem Tov in the early eighteenth century, and the revolution of Rabbi Schneur Zalman, the Alter Rebbe, to create a model with which the energy and ideas of Chassidus can be internalized.


In conclusion, we study the "author's title page", where we learn the mission of the book: to understand how Judaism is "within reach" and meaningful on a deep level, and that this book takes the "long-but-short" approach.
